Lilia Omietonska is the founder and photographer of Shades of Feminity, a studio specialising in female portraits. In this short film, we go behind the scenes to witness how Lilia conducts her photography sessions and the extra mile she goes to connect with her subjects, making them feel at ease and, most importantly, powerful. Getting your photo taken can be stressful and uncomfortable for many people. I remember always feeling awkward about passport photos or any kind of pictures. That’s why a video that shows behind-the-scenes of your service or product can be a great way to comfort and connect with your audience, especially if they’re facing similar challenges.
For this video, I took a documentary-style approach, capturing the photographer in her natural environment. But before starting, I made sure to introduce myself to the client and break the ice. This is an important step because building a connection with your clients is key to making a good video. It helps create a comfortable environment, leading to more authentic footage.
